| // IStream.h |
| |
| #ifndef __ISTREAM_H |
| #define __ISTREAM_H |
| |
| #include "../Common/MyUnknown.h" |
| #include "../Common/Types.h" |
| |
| // "23170F69-40C1-278A-0000-000300xx0000" |
| |
| #define STREAM_INTERFACE_SUB(i, b, x) \ |
| DEFINE_GUID(IID_ ## i, \ |
| 0x23170F69, 0x40C1, 0x278A, 0x00, 0x00, 0x00, 0x03, 0x00, x, 0x00, 0x00); \ |
| struct i: public b |
| |
| #define STREAM_INTERFACE(i, x) STREAM_INTERFACE_SUB(i, IUnknown, x) |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E(ISequentialInStream, 0x01)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(Read)(void *data, UInt32 size, UInt32 *processedSize) PURE; |
| /* |
| Out: if size != 0, return_value = S_OK and (*processedSize == 0), |
| then there are no more bytes in stream. |
| if (size > 0) && there are bytes in stream, |
| this function must read at least 1 byte. |
| This function is allowed to read less than number of remaining bytes in stream. |
| You must call Read function in loop, if you need exact amount of data |
| */ |
| }; |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E(ISequentialOutStream, 0x02)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(Write)(const void *data, UInt32 size, UInt32 *processedSize) PURE; |
| /* |
| if (size > 0) this function must write at least 1 byte. |
| This function is allowed to write less than "size". |
| You must call Write function in loop, if you need to write exact amount of data |
| */ |
| }; |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E_SUB(IInStream, ISequentialInStream, 0x03)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(Seek)(Int64 offset, UInt32 seekOrigin, UInt64 *newPosition) PURE; |
| }; |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E_SUB(IOutStream, ISequentialOutStream, 0x04)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(Seek)(Int64 offset, UInt32 seekOrigin, UInt64 *newPosition) PURE; |
| STDMETHOD(SetSize)(Int64 newSize) PURE; |
| }; |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E(IStreamGetSize, 0x06)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(GetSize)(UInt64 *size) PURE; |
| }; |
| |
| STREAM_INTERFACE(IOutStreamFlush, 0x07) |
| { |
| STDMETHOD(Flush)() PURE; |
| }; |
| |
| #endif |
